=== Hindu restoration === The Hindu restoration began around 1243 AD, with the death of Jayavarman VII's successor, [[Indravarman II]]. The next king, [[Jayavarman VIII]], was a Shaivite iconoclast who specialized in destroying Buddhist images and in reestablishing the Hindu shrines that his illustrious predecessor had converted to Buddhism. During the restoration, the Bayon was made a temple to Shiva, and its central 3.6 meter tall statue of the Buddha was cast to the bottom of a nearby well. Everywhere, cultist statues of the Buddha were replaced by lingams.{{sfn|Higham|2001|p=133}}
